📝 Ingredients

Carbonated Water, Eaas (l-Leucine, L-Isoleucine, L-Valine, L-Threonine, L-Lysine, L-Phenylalanine, L-Histidine, L-Methionine, L-Tryptophan), Betaine Anhydrous, Natural Flavors, Malic Acid, Citric Acid, Tartaric Acid, Caffeine, Sodium Benzoate and Potassium Sorbate (preserve Freshness), Cognizin (citicoline), Vitamin B3 (niacinamide), Vitamin B6 (pyridoxine Hydrochloride), and Vitamin B12 (methylcobalamin).

💬 Nutrition Q&A: Purple Kiddles Energy Drink

Is Purple Kiddles Energy Drink good for weight loss?

At under 5 calories per bottle, this drink is essentially calorie-free and won't interfere with weight loss efforts. However, it contains no fiber, protein, or meaningful nutrients to support satiety, so it works best as a beverage complement rather than a meal component.

Is Purple Kiddles Energy Drink a good snack for kids?

While the drink contains amino acids and B vitamins that support body function, it includes caffeine, which isn't recommended for children. The minimal calorie and nutrient content also makes it unsuitable as a nutritional beverage for kids.

What diets does Purple Kiddles Energy Drink suit?

This drink aligns well with zero-carb, keto, and low-calorie diets. It's also suitable for those following intermittent fasting or anyone avoiding sugar and carbohydrates.

What does Purple Kiddles Energy Drink pair well with for a balanced meal?

This drink pairs best with balanced meals containing protein and whole foods. Pair it with a meal featuring lean protein, vegetables, and whole grains to create nutritional balance, since the drink itself provides no macronutrients.

How does Purple Kiddles Energy Drink fit into a balanced diet?

Purple Kiddles functions as a functional beverage rather than a nutritional staple, offering B vitamins and amino acids in negligible amounts. To fit into a balanced diet, rely on whole foods for your carbohydrates, proteins, and fats, and use this drink primarily for hydration and a caffeine boost.
